Description

This delightful three-bedroom semi- detached home is sure to catch your eye.

Situated in the lovely village of Church Lawton with local amenities close by and fantastic transport routes, whilst benefiting from superb rear views of the open countryside and canal.
You are firstly welcomed into a stunning entrance hallway showcasing original tiled flooring and cleverly designed bespoke built in understairs cabinetry.

This attractive home has been immaculately cared for by the current owners, with the main lounge being enhanced with a cozy feature fireplace whilst in the open plan dining kitchen there is a modern on-trend kitchen, with plentiful space to dine and entertain.

For your convenience there is a separate utility area and downstairs cloakroom.

To the first floor there are there two double bedrooms and a single bedroom, the family bathroom offers a four-piece suite with a separate shower enclosure and a freestanding bath.

Externally the property commands a fantastic size cobbled and gravelled driveway, offering plentiful private parking for multiple vehicles.

To the rear of the home there is a lawned garden and paved patio area, and as previously mentioned those all-important views of the open countryside and Macclesfield canal.

Whittaker & Biggs is the longest established practice of its type in the area dating back to 1931 when it operated the Livestock Market and offices in Congleton town centre.

The firm now have estate agency offices sited in prime locations in Macclesfield, Leek, Congleton and Biddulph with fully qualified valuers in each. There are six Partners and a total workforce of approximately 50 people.
